Tahitian pearls, celebrated for their lustrous hues and rare beauty, have long enthralled the imagination of those who desire the finest treasures of the ocean. These dark gems, commonly ranging from black to purple, are found exclusively in the seas of French Polynesia. A Tahitian pearl is more than just a jewel; it's a emblem of elegance.

Secrets of a Tahitian Pearl Farm

The gentle caress upon the turquoise waters of Tahiti reveals a hidden realm. Within these tranquil lagoons, nestled amidst swaying coral reefs and vibrant marine life, lie secret farms – Tahitian pearl farms. These sanctuaries are in which nature's artistry takes center stage, transforming humble oysters into shimmering treasures. The art of cultivating pearls is a delicate ballet, demanding patience, expertise, and a deep connection for the ocean's intricate rhythms.

  • Stories tell about ancient Tahitian deities who favored these waters with their essence.
  • Today, skilled pearl farmers carry on this heritage with reverence for the sea and its creatures.

Their|Theyr work involves carefully selecting oysters, inserting tiny pearl nuclei, and observing their growth over many months. The result is a breathtaking display of nature's artistry – iridescent pearls that capture the very essence of the South Pacific.
